1. Are You at Higher Risk During Flu Season?

The first thing to do when cold and flu season arrives is not to panic. Instead, assess whether you fall into one of the higher-risk groups below:

  • Children under 18
  • Individuals aged 50 years or older
  • Pregnant women
  • Busy, high-stress professionals
Children Under 18

Children, adolescents, and young adults typically have weaker immune systems. This is especially true for those under 12, as their major immune organ—the thymus—is still developing. They must wait until the thymus fully matures before it can transition its primary functions to other immune organs, similar to adults.

Persons Aged 50 and Older

It's important to note that some individuals aged 50 and older can still possess strong immunity, helping them combat viruses more effectively than others in the same age group. However, this greatly depends on their lifestyle choices. Those who maintain regular physical activity, eat a balanced diet, and follow a disciplined sleep schedule are likely to have better immune systems compared to their peers who do not prioritize healthy habits.

Pregnant Women

There is no evidence suggesting that pregnant women are more susceptible to illness than others. However, from a prevention standpoint, seasonal influenza vaccination is important for reducing acute respiratory infections for both mothers and infants, as well as minimizing cardiopulmonary complications and associated hospitalizations in pregnant women. For more information, refer to the Centre for Health Protection.

Busy High-Stress Professionals

Yes, please take a closer look if you work as a corporate professional. In a hectic work environment, sitting in an air-conditioned office and consuming more than three cups of coffee daily can accumulate stress on your brain, ultimately suppressing your immunity, as explained by physiology.

FAQ 1: Can Colds Heal on Their Own Without Treatment?

Yes, colds typically heal on their own within a week due to the body's natural healing mechanisms. However, if symptoms persist longer than that, it may indicate that the immune system is not functioning properly, and you should consult a doctor immediately.

FAQ 2: Is Poor Immunity Reversible?

While some individuals may struggle due to immune diseases, poor immunity can often be reversed by developing a healthy lifestyle.
